"The matrix, the essential condition, of nearly every other flexibility" that's how Justice Benjamin Cardozo referred to freedom of expression. This distinguished Justice is much from alone in his assessment of the lofty perch that free speech holds in the United States of America. Others have actually called it our blueprint for personal freedom and the foundation of a totally free culture.


The First Amendment of the United States Constitution provides that "Congress will make no law. abridging the free speech." This flexibility represents the significance of personal freedom and private freedom. It continues to be critically important, since free speech is completely intertwined with liberty of idea.
